Pollution and ecological risk evaluate for the environmentally impact on Karnaphuli river, Bangladesh
Authors
Md. Ripaj Uddin, Riyadh Hossen Bhuyain, Muhammad Edris Ali, Md. Aminul Ahsan
Abstract
Samples were collected low tide period from ten points in three seasons such as the pre- monsoon (November- February), monsoon (March–June) and post-monsoon (July–October), during 2015-2016. Samples were analyzed for finding of some metals concentration such as Na, K, Ca, Mg, Fe, Pb, Cu, Zn, Cd, As, Cr and Mn. The mean value was reported for each parameter. The investigated parameters were compared to national and international Standard. The concentration of some metals such as Na, K, Ca, Mg, Fe, Pb, Cu, Zn, Cd, As, Cr and Mn were found to be 327.24 ppm, 24.65 ppm, 29.42 ppm, 44.35 ppm, 15.28 ppm, 15.52 ppb, 0.018 ppm, 0.072 ppm, 0.066 ppm, <0.05 ppm, 0.62 ppm & 0.355 ppm respectively. The heavy metal pollution index (HPI) was found to be 1479.89 which was upper of the critical index limit of 100 and also indicates unsuitable for Drinking.
